Abstract
A data processing system is operable in a first state to use a first instruction set having a first instruction set encoding. The data processing system is also operable in a second state to use a second instruction set having a second instruction encoding. Conditional branch instructions provided within the two different instruction sets are arranged to use the same instruction encoding.
